I'm shortly due to go buy a new copy of XP for a second computer. Is it
possible to use this new install CD on my first computer, but use the license
key that came with its original copy of XP, so as to perform a full reinstall
to SP2 in the future if need be ?

I'm NOT wanting to run one copy on two machines, just save a little time
when coming to reinstall the original version of XP to SP2. I'm not sure if
license keys that come with XP are version or build locked or anything
similar.

Thanks in advance.
 
Before anyone comments, this applies to WinXP Home edition in both instances.
Thanks.
 
Andre;
Both licenses must be the same type for both Product Keys to work with
the new CD.
Retail vs. OEM
Full vs. Upgrade
Home vs. Pro
Etc.
